Eco friendly stoves
Eco-efficient hearth stoves, also identified as eco-friendly or energy-efficient wood-burning stoves, are designed to provide warmth and ambiance whereas minimizing their influence on the surroundings. These stoves are constructed to burn wood more efficiently and produce fewer emissions, serving to to minimize back air pollution and preserve vitality. Here are some features and considerations for eco-efficient hearth stoves:
High Efficiency: Look for stoves with high efficiency scores. These stoves extract more heat from the wooden and release much less waste by way of the chimney. Efficiency rankings are normally indicated as a proportion and may vary between totally different fashions.
EPA Certification: In many international locations, including the United States,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) certifies wood stoves for emissions and efficiency. Choosing an EPA-certified stove ensures that it meets sure environmental requirements and burns wooden more cleanly.
Cleaner Burning Technology: Many eco-efficient stoves incorporate superior combustion technology to make sure cleaner burning. This would possibly embody options like secondary combustion, catalytic converters, and air supply controls to optimize combustion and reduce emissions.
Air Wash System: A built-in air wash system helps hold the glass window of the range clear by directing a stream of air over it, preventing soot and creosote buildup and maintaining a clear view of the flames.

Size and Heat Output: Choose a stove that's appropriately sized for the house you propose to warmth. An oversized range may result in overheating and inefficient burning.
Wood Quality: Burning dry, seasoned wood is essential for optimum performance and effectivity. Wet or green wood can produce extra smoke and creosote buildup, reducing stove efficiency and potentially posing a fireplace hazard.
Multi-Fuel Options: Some stoves can burn multiple types of gasoline, such as wooden pellets, which are a more constant and environment friendly gas supply in comparison with conventional logs.
Eco-Friendly Materials: Stoves created from sustainable and eco-friendly supplies, such as recycled or regionally sourced steel, contribute to their general environmental impact.

Regular Maintenance: To preserve effectivity and forestall creosote buildup, which may result in chimney fires, regular cleansing and maintenance of the stove and chimney are important.
Local Regulations: Check native laws and requirements related to wood-burning stoves, together with emission requirements and restrictions on burning certain forms of wooden.
